xml record Ir.rule断言错误:元素odoo有额外的内容:record

xml record Ir.rule断言错误:元素odoo有额外的内容:record,odoo,odoo-10,Odoo,Odoo 10,此记录定义有错误 <record id="file_rule_canceled" model="ir.rule"> <filed name="name"> File Canceled=True User Cann't Read</filed> <field name="model_id" ref="model_muk_dms_file"/> <field name="perm_read" eval="False"/&

此记录定义有错误

<record id="file_rule_canceled" model="ir.rule">
    <filed name="name"> File Canceled=True  User Cann't Read</filed>
    <field name="model_id" ref="model_muk_dms_file"/>
    <field name="perm_read" eval="False"/>
    <field name="perm_write" eval="False"/>
    <field name="perm_create" eval="False"/>
    <field name="perm_unlink" eval="False"/>
    <field name="domain_force">[('canceled','=','True')] </field>
    <field name="groups" eval="[(4, ref('group_gesion_dms_general_manager')), (4, ref('group_gesion_dms_manager')),(4, ref('group_gesion_dms_designer')),(4,ref('group_gesion_dms_reader'))]"/>
</record>
你能帮我找出问题所在吗?

试试这个:

<record id="file_rule_canceled" model="ir.rule">
    <field name="name">File Canceled=True User Can't Read</field>
    <field name="model_id" ref="model_muk_dms_file"/>
    <field name="perm_read" eval="False"/>
    <field name="perm_write" eval="False"/>
    <field name="perm_create" eval="False"/>
    <field name="perm_unlink" eval="False"/>
    <field name="domain_force">[('canceled','=','True')]</field>
    <field name="groups" eval="[(4, ref('group_gesion_dms_general_manager')), (4, ref('group_gesion_dms_manager')),(4, ref('group_gesion_dms_designer')),(4,ref('group_gesion_dms_reader'))]"/>
</record>

文件已取消=真用户无法读取
[('cancelled','=','True')]

如果能找出问题所在,那就太好了;-)例如,键入的
字段
,应该是
字段
。请在你的答案中添加一些内容,这将有助于更好地理解它。
<record id="file_rule_canceled" model="ir.rule">
    <field name="name">File Canceled=True User Can't Read</field>
    <field name="model_id" ref="model_muk_dms_file"/>
    <field name="perm_read" eval="False"/>
    <field name="perm_write" eval="False"/>
    <field name="perm_create" eval="False"/>
    <field name="perm_unlink" eval="False"/>
    <field name="domain_force">[('canceled','=','True')]</field>
    <field name="groups" eval="[(4, ref('group_gesion_dms_general_manager')), (4, ref('group_gesion_dms_manager')),(4, ref('group_gesion_dms_designer')),(4,ref('group_gesion_dms_reader'))]"/>
</record>